- Franking credits and cryptocurrency investments may seem unrelated, but they both have an impact on an individual's tax obligations. Franking credits are tax credits that are attached to dividends paid by Australian companies. These credits can be used to offset the individual's tax liability. On the other hand, cryptocurrency investments involve buying and selling digital currencies like Bitcoin or Ethereum. The profits made from cryptocurrency investments are subject to capital gains tax. Therefore, if an individual receives franking credits from Australian companies and also earns profits from cryptocurrency investments, both will affect their overall tax situation.
